HTC Rhyme Announced; Coming To Verizon On September 29
HTC recently announced the much-awaited HTC Rhyme smartphone. This handset runs on the latest Android 2.3 (Gingerbread) Operating System and it comes with a 3.7 inch WVGA display, HTC Sense UI 3.5, 5 megapixel autofocus camera and much more. HTC Rhyme will be first launched in the US, exclusively for the subscribers of Verizon Wireless.
3.7 inch WVGA display480 x 800 pixels resolution1GHz Qualcomm MSM8255 processorAndroid 2.3 (Gingerbread) OSHTC Sense UI 3.55 megapixel camera with LED flashAuto-focusHD (720p) video recordingVGA front-facing camera3.5mm headset jackStereo FM radio with RDS4 GB internal memoryMicroSD card32 GB expandable memory8 GB MicroSD card included768 MB RAMBluetooth 3.0 with A2DPWi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n3G ConnectivityAndroid Market1600 mAh batteryHTC Rhyme comes with exclusive accessories such as a Charm cable, sports armband and a Bluetooth headset. This handset will be available for Verizon subscribers from September 29. The price of this handset has not been announced yet. The HTC Rhyme is expected to launch next month in Europe and Asia.
[ Update: HTC Rhyme will be exclusively available at Target stores in the US. You can get this handset for just $199.99 with a 2 year service agreement.]
